Lundbrygga
Imposing and solid, Lundbrygga lies in the center of Sjøvegan. Located on the site of an older pier, it was built sometime after World War I and before World War II.
Sjøvegan has a long tradition in trading. Johan Falk Henriksen came here in 1864 and started his business with shop, ware-house, guest house, bakery and forge. Sjøvegan became a natural meeting point between coastal and inland culture in Salangen county. Lundbrygga was erected in the inter-war period and houses today a maritime collection, thematic exhibitions, and museum shop.
